General Description:
Men2xnf8 fails with return code 1.ENWrite may fail during Men2XNF8 (return code 1) with the following error (as seen in the men2xnf8.log file):
// ENWrite has detected an exception condition during processing -- Printing Status Messages // Warning: An instance in a model references part $PONY/express/part interface express which cannot have its pins mapped to the new superseding interface (from: DDMS/EDDM/EDDM General 18) // Error: Pin mapping from part $PONY/express/part interface express to superseding interface is not possible because at least one pin cannot be found in the superseding interface (from: DDMS/EDDM/EDDM Connectivity 10)
ソリューション
This may be caused by a mismatch between a pin name on a symbol and what is known as the "compiled pin name."
To correct this, go into PLD_DA and open the symbol for the named interface in the error message. Select Check -> With Defaults. The Check Pin section of the Check report may show something like this:
WARNING: Compiled pin name "D-DO-DO-DO" and PIN "D-D-DA-DA-DA" on P$2 do not match.
Select the pin labelled "D-DO-DO-DO" then select Miscellaneous -> Change Compiled Pin Name. Type "D-D-DA-DA-DA" in the dialog box. Check and save the symbol, then rerun Men2XNF8.
